Collingwood’s Head of High Performance Jarrod Wade has provided an injury and health update ahead of Collingwood’s Round 18 match against the Gold Coast SUNS at People First Stadium on Friday night.
Available:
Ash Johnson
Ash Johnson’s return to play was delayed last week due to illness. Johnson has since recovered and will be available for limited minutes in the VFL this weekend.
Test:
Lachie Schultz
Lachie Schultz has completed a rehab program for his hamstring injury and has returned to full training this week. Schultz will train fully tomorrow and is expected to be available for selection.
Unavailable:
Beau McCreery
Beau McCreery has increased the intensity and volume of his rehab program as he recovers from a hamstring strain. McCreery is expected to complete his rehab this week and return to full training next week.
Billy Frampton
Billy Frampton is progressing well as he recovers from a calf strain. Frampton has started to integrate back into team training whilst building intensity and volume in his conditioning program. An assessment will be made next week to determine his availability over the next fortnight.
Other updates:
Jordan De Goey (Achilles/concussion), Harvey Harrison (ACL), Tew Jiath (quad/hip), Fin Macrae (shoulder), Reef McInnes (ACL), Jakob Ryan (foot) and Charlie West (foot) are all progressing well with their individual rehab programs.
